Output e0696cc77885d6703e1f6403e1b121c95a4e919418e4ad08757dbd9678b3025f:187

value
2336697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b4faffff18aa074861c68055a0b6628af7a2e21 OP_EQUAL
address
38ZE4iTLSXf2rTwhj71fWBM7nRGjwgmwb3
transaction
e0696cc77885d6703e1f6403e1b121c95a4e919418e4ad08757dbd9678b3025f